The Hebron Board of Selectmen approved a bid waiver and awarded the fiscal‑year 2025–26 road resurfacing contract to Glasgow Materials, following a recommendation by Public Works Director Paul Forrest.
Forrest explained Glasgow will be working in the neighboring district (Marlborough) and could extend state bid pricing to Hebron for adjacent work; the company offered competitive pricing on both milling and paving and could start as soon as the following week on Skinner Lane with a later return in August to complete other projects. Forrest said Glasgow’s combined milling and paving pricing was lower than other bids and that the firm had capacity for the town’s schedule.
Selectmen approved the bid waiver and award by voice vote. The public works director will coordinate scheduling and contract details and will provide the board with the project timetable and street list for the FY 2025–26 resurfacing work.
